随着区块链技术的快速发展,数字货币的使用愈发普及,而钱包作为其重要工具之一,备受关注。imToken是目前市场上最受欢迎的数字钱包之一,其接口功能强大,深受用户青睐。本文将围绕imToken钱包接口展开内容,提供实用建议和技巧,助您更高效地管理数字资产。
什么是imToken钱包接口?
imToken钱包接口是指针对开发者和用户提供的API(应用程序接口),可以实现与imToken钱包的多种功能交互。通过接口,开发者能够实现智能合约的调用、资产的转移以及数据的查询等。不仅能提升用户体验,还能为各类应用提供便捷的数字资产管理解决方案。
高效使用imToken钱包接口的五个技巧

以下是五个实用的技巧,帮助您高效使用imToken钱包接口,从而提升数字资产管理的效率。
技巧一:充分利用API文档
在开始使用imToken钱包接口前,建议仔细阅读官方的API文档。文档通常包含了接口的所有细节:包括参数、返回值、调用方法及使用注意事项。通过学习API文档,开发者能够快速了解接口功能,降低使用中的错误概率Android。
实际应用:开发者在调用接口进行资产转移时,若事先了解每个参数的具体作用和要求,就能在编码时有效避免遗漏和错误,从而节省调试时间,提高开发效率。
技巧二:模块化设计代码
在项目开发中,建议采用模块化设计方法,将与imToken钱包接口相关的功能抽象为独立的模块。这样可以让代码更清晰、更易维护。若未来需要添加新功能或修改现有功能时,能够轻松应对。
实际应用:开发一个数字资产管理平台时,可以将imToken钱包接口的调用封装到一个单独的类或模块中,其他部分的代码不需修改,只需调用这个模块的方法即可快速实现资产转移或余额查询。
技巧三:异步调用提高性能
在处理大量API请求时,采用异步调用可以显著提高性能。使用异步编程模型,能够让请求并行处理,而不是依次等待返回结果,这对于大量用户同时操作时,尤为重要。
实际应用:在一个DApp(去中心化应用)中,用户同时进行多个交易请求,可以使用异步调用来同时处理这些请求,确保每个操作能够在短时间内被用户反馈,提升用户体验。
技巧四:实现错误处理机制
在使用imToken钱包接口时,良好的错误处理机制不可或缺。接口请求可能因网络问题、参数错误等原因失败,开发者应设计合理的错误处理逻辑,及时向用户反馈并进行相应的处理。
实际应用:若用户在转账时发生错误,系统应根据错误类型,向用户提供明确的信息,例如“余额不足”、“地址格式不正确”等提示,并建议用户进行相应操作。
技巧五:定期更新和优化代码
随着imToken钱包接口的迭代更新,可能会发布新的功能或修改现有功能。定期检查和更新使用的接口版本,并根据新的API文档优化代码,可以充分利用最新的功能,提高应用的整体性能和用户体验。
实际应用:开发团队定期查看imToken的API变更日志,及时更新代码,以优化资产转移的处理速度和安全性,确保用户能够使用到最新、最安全的功能。
imToken钱包接口的应用场景
常见问题解答
是的,使用imToken钱包接口通常需要一定的开发经验。开发者需要了解API的基本使用方法,包括如何发送请求、接收响应等。此外,了解基本的编程语言(如JavaScript、Python等)也是必需的。
安全性是数字资产管理中非常重要的考虑因素。在调用imToken钱包接口时,建议采取以下措施来保障安全性:
使用HTTPS协议进行通信,以加密数据传输;
定期更新接口密钥和秘钥;
在代码中严格验证用户输入,避免注入攻击;
使用合适的鉴权机制,确保只有授权用户才能调用接口。
如果在使用imToken钱包接口时发生错误,开发者需根据返回的错误代码进行处理。通常,API会返回错误类型和描述信息,开发者可以根据这些信息进行相应的调试和修复。例如,若返回“429 Too Many Requests”,说明请求频率过快,开发者应调整请求策略,降低请求频率。
imToken钱包接口支持多种数字货币,主要包括以太坊及其ERC20代币、比特币等主流数字资产。具体支持的币种列表可参考官方文档,确保开发者在调用接口前了解所支持的币种范围。
接入imToken钱包接口的流程一般包括以下步骤:
imToken钱包接口的使用方式及其相关费用应参考官方说明,通常情况下,调用某些服务可能会产生费用。具体费用结构可能根据应用类型、使用频率等有所不同。因此,在使用前建议了解相应的政策。
通过以上的实用建议和技巧,相信您能更加高效并安全地使用imToken钱包接口,提升数字资产管理的整体效率!